pandemic
English Thesaurus
1. an epidemic that is geographically widespread; occurring throughout a region or even throughout the world (noun.event)
| hypernym | : | epidemic, |
| definition | : | a widespread outbreak of an infectious disease; many people are infected at the same time (noun.event) |
2. existing everywhere (adj.all)
| similar | : | general, |
| definition | : | applying to all or most members of a category or group (adj.all) |
3. epidemic over a wide geographical area (adj.all)
| similar | : | epidemic, |
| definition | : | (especially of medicine) of disease or anything resembling a disease; attacking or affecting many individuals in a community or a population simultaneously (adj.all) |
